scholarly journals Penerapan Model Pembelajaran Inside-Outside Circle untuk Meningkatkan Aktivitas Belajar Siswa pada Mata Pelajaran PKn

Author(s):  
Timour Ambarita

The purpose of this research are: (1) To increase student learning activity on Civic subject by using Inside-Outside Circle model. (2) To improve learning outcomes by using Inside-Outside Circle technique. This type of research is classroom action research (CAR). Implementation carried out as much as 2 cycles, each cycle consists of planning, action, observation, and reflection. The subjects of the study were the fourth grade students of SDN 101768 Tembung. Data collection techniques used were interviews, observations and tests. The results show that the use of Inside-Outside Circle model can increase student activity and learning result which is seen from the increase of active participation of students in group discussion, ability to identify learning with Inside-Outside Circle model. Improved learning process is able to increase student learning activities. The liveliness of students in asking before action 14,81%, in cycle I is 37,2%, in cycle II is 81,45%. The activity of students in answering questions before action 7.4%, in the first cycle is 37.03%, the second cycle is 74.07%. Student activity in attitude before action of 7,4%, in cycle I is 44,4%, in cycle II is 74,07%. Activity of student in doing problem independently before action 37,03%, in cycle I is 55,5%, in cycle II is 74,07%. Value of PKN student learning outcomes before action is only 31.25% with an average score of 56.5 while in cycle I, the value of student learning outcomes increased to 62.5% with a mean score of 70.31. In the second cycle the value of student learning outcomes that reach KKM is 81.25% with an average value of 74.06.

This study aims to determine student learning outcomes in Arabic subjects before the application of Big Book media, the process of applying Big Book media and student learning outcomes after the application of Big Book media in class IV MI Naelushibyan. The research method used is classroom action research through four repetitive stages of planning, implementation, observation or observation, and reflection. The object of research was 15 students. The research instrument consisted of a teacher activity observation sheet, a student activity observation sheet and a written test. Data collection techniques use observation and test techniques. The results obtained from this study are the learning outcomes of students in the pre cycle get an average score of 53. The first cycle obtained the average value of teacher activity 72.2% and cycle II obtained an average value of 94.4%. Student activity in cycle I obtained an average value of 69.21% and cycle II obtained an average value of 91.07%. Student learning outcomes in cycle I obtained an average value of 77, cycle II obtained an average value of 83.6. It can be concluded that Big Book media can improve student learning outcomes.

This study aims to improve the activities and learning outcomes of thematic learning in grade II elementary school students through the application of picture and picture models. The research method used was classroom action research (clascroom action research) with a cycle of Kemmis and Taggart using 4 stages namely planning, action, observation, reflection. Research subjects with 27 students consisting of 14 men and 13 women. The results of the study stated that an increase in student activity and learning outcomes in thematic learning in class II, this can be seen from the increase in the average acquisition of student activity scores in the first cycle obtained an average score of 31 increased to 35.5 with a good category in the second cycle. Then the learning outcomes are proven from the average value and the percentage of student learning in the form of cognitive, affective and psychomotor values. Cognitive Value The highest average value is in the natural science subjects at 84.16 with the percentage of student learning reaching 100% and the lowest average value in mathematics subjects at 80.83 with the percentage of student learning only reaching 83.39%. Affective value, the highest percentage of criteria namely in SBK, Natural Sciences and Civics reached 88.88% or as many as 24 people and the lowest percentage of criteria namely in mathematics subjects only reached 81.48% or as many as 22 people. Psychomotor scores, the highest percentage of criteria namely SBK, Natural Sciences and Civics reached 88.88% or as many as 24 people and the lowest percentage of criteria namely in Mathematics and Social Sciences subjects only reached 85.18% or as many as 23 people. The conclusion is that the application of picture and picture models in grade II elementary schools can increase the activities and learning outcomes of thematic learning.
